Optional Redemption Provisions:

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

Make-whole Redemption:

 

At any time prior to maturity, in the case of the 2019 Notes, and at any time prior to February 15, 2022 (in the case of the 2022 Notes), January 15, 2024 (in the case of the 2024 Notes), December 15, 2026 (in the case of the 2027 Notes) and October 15, 2046 (in the case of the 2047 Notes), in whole or in part, at the greater of 100% of the principal amount of notes being redeemed and a make-whole redemption price determined by using a discount rate of the applicable Treasury Rate plus 15 basis points in the case of the 2019 Notes, 15 basis points in the case of the 2022 Notes, 15 basis points in the case of the 2024 Notes, 20 basis points in the case of the 2027 Notes and 25 basis points, in the case of the 2047 Notes, plus, in each case, accrued and unpaid interest to but not including the redemption date.

 

 

 

Par Redemption:

 

At any time on or after February 15, 2022 (in the case of the 2022 Notes), January 15, 2024 (in the case of the 2024 Notes), December 15, 2026 (in the case of the 2027 Notes) and October 15, 2046 (in the case of the 2047 Notes), in whole or in part, at 100% of the principal amount of the notes being redeemed, plus, in each case, accrued and unpaid interest to but not including the redemption date.

 

 

 

Special Acquisition Redemption:

 

If the Company (i) terminates or abandons the acquisition of B/E Aerospace, Inc. before 5:00 p.m. (New York City time) on October 21, 2017 (the “Special Acquisition Redemption Date”) or (ii) the merger agreement with respect to the acquisition is terminated before such time, the Company will redeem all outstanding 2022 Notes, 2024 Notes, 2027 Notes and 2047 Notes at 101% of the aggregate principal amount of the notes to be redeemed, plus accrued and unpaid interest to but excluding the Special Acquisition Redemption Date. The 2019 Notes are not subject to the special acquisition redemption.

We expect that delivery of the notes will be made to investors on or about April 10, 2017, which will be the ninth business day following the date of the pricing of the notes. Under Rule 15c6-1 under the Exchange Act, trades in the secondary market are required, subject to certain exceptions, to settle in three business days, unless the parties to any such trade expressly agree otherwise. Accordingly, purchasers who wish to trade the notes on the date of pricing or the next six succeeding business days will be required, by virtue of the fact that the notes will initially settle in T+9, to specify an alternate settlement arrangement at the time of any such trade to prevent a failed settlement. Those purchasers should consult their advisors.
